When it comes to photography, location plays a pivotal role in setting the mood and enhancing the overall aesthetic. Indoor photoshoots offer photographers a controlled environment, allowing them to play with lighting, backgrounds, and various elements to create stunning images. Whether you’re a professional photographer or simply looking for the perfect spot for your next Instagram post, finding the right indoor location can make all the difference.
In this article, we’ll explore some of the best indoor photoshoot locations, from modern studios to cozy cafés, and give you tips on how to maximize your session. Let’s dive into the world of indoor photography and uncover how you can take your photos to the next level!
Photography studios are the go-to option for many professional and amateur photographers alike. Studios provide a blank canvas, with controlled lighting, backdrops, and props to suit different needs. Whether you’re looking for a minimalist setting or a dramatic scene, studios offer the flexibility to create any style you want.
Art galleries and museums can offer unique backdrops for your indoor photoshoot. With their intricate architecture, stunning artworks, and vast open spaces, these venues provide an inspiring atmosphere. The interplay of natural and artificial light can create a dynamic setting for your photos.
Cafés and restaurants, with their cozy ambiance and aesthetically pleasing décor, make for perfect indoor photoshoot spots. Many modern cafés have unique interior designs, complete with natural lighting, stylish furniture, and eye-catching wall art.
Hotel lobbies and lounges are another great option for indoor photoshoots. Many high-end hotels offer luxurious interiors, with modern architecture, elegant furniture, and beautifully crafted details.
Indoor botanical gardens, with their lush greenery and colorful flowers, provide a refreshing change of scenery for your photoshoots. These spaces offer natural beauty and tranquil settings, perfect for portrait or fashion photography.
For a more edgy, urban vibe, consider renting an industrial space or warehouse for your indoor photoshoot. These locations often have high ceilings, exposed brick walls, metal structures, and a raw, unfinished look that can give your photos a modern, gritty appeal.
